Web21. Cup without a stem, or with a stubby or rudimentary stem. 34. 22. Growing from sticks or (sometimes buried) woody debris in spring in eastern North America; goblet-shaped when young; inner/upper surface black; outer/under surface brown to black, usually scaly; stem black, tapered to base. Urnula craterium. WebHow to Use the Bolete Filter – A “Synoptic Key” Tradition creates some kind of “dichotomous” key to identify particular mushrooms. For example, you might start with …
